CareFirst and CVS Partnership
CareFirst has renewed its agreement with CVS Caremark to provide pharmacy benefit and other related services to its commercial and health care exchange members through 2023.
CareFirst and CVS Caremark have a long-standing partnership, with CVS Caremark managing the pharmacy benefit for CareFirst since 2014.
CVS Caremark will continue to provide a specialized account team to help support the integration of pharmacy data and information into key CareFirst initiatives, including CareFirst’s Patient-Centered Medical Home (PCMH) and Total Care and Cost Improvement (TCCI) programs.
These programs aim to improve care quality while reducing or slowing the rise of care costs.
CVS Caremark will also continue to provide CVS Specialty, the specialty pharmacy of CVS Health, to CareFirst members taking specialty medications.
CareFirst members can use CVS Specialty for 24/7 access to specially trained nurses and pharmacists that provide disease management services and support.
CareFirst members taking specialty medications can also pick up their prescriptions at any CVS Pharmacy location or have them delivered.

Save More with Mail Service

You can save more by using the mail service, which offers a convenient way to order your prescriptions from home.
To get started, simply call 1-877-673-3688 and ask for the FastStart service. This will give you the fastest service available.
For mail orders, complete the Mail Service Order Form and mail it along with your prescription and payment to CVS Caremark at P.O. Box 659541, San Antonio, TX 78265-9541.
You can pay by VISA, MasterCard, Discover, American Express, check, or money order. Please note that cash is not accepted.
Standard shipping is free, but expedited shipping is available for an additional cost. Allow 10-14 days for delivery of your medication from the day you mail your order.

Are CVS and CVS Caremark the same thing?
No, CVS and CVS Caremark are not the same thing. CVS Caremark is actually the pharmacy benefit management business of CVS Health, a separate entity from the retail business known as CVS/pharmacy.
